WhatsApp: +86 18203695377WEBUnlike the float–sink test, froth flotation does not depend on density differences to effect the separation. In a froth flotation cell, a stream of air bubbles passes upward through an agitated bath containing fine coal slurry. The vitriniterich coal attaches to the air bubbles which float to the top of the cell.

WhatsApp: +86 18203695377WEBJul 1, 2017 · The performance of floatsink coal cleaning devices customarily is characterized by a distribution curve, in which the percent of feed reporting to clean coal is plotted against specific gravity.
WhatsApp: +86 18203695377WEBJan 1, 1994 · The lowest residual sulfur levels ever attained by caustic leaching of Illinois No. 6 coal samples have resulted from the appliion of a combined floatsink/leaching (FL) process in which 50% aqueous NaOH solutions serve as the heavy medium during the floatsink step and as the reagent during subsequent atmospheric pressure leaching.
